On January 10, 2007 WERA Director Aaron Jasper and President Brent Granby and the Renters At Risk Campaign members held a media event to support Mark Allman.
Mark Allman was disputing an eviction order at the BC Supreme Court to save his home in Richmond BC. Mark Allman and other Richmond Garden tenants were at the B.C. Court of Appeal fighting the eviction from their landlord, Amacon.
Last year, Amacon evicted many tenants in the 240-unit complex for renovations. While many of the tenants who disputed their evictions at the RTO won their cases, 37 tenants lost. Those tenants appealed at the Supreme Court of BC and a landmark ruling in May 2006 overturned the RTO decision. Amacon appealed the tenant’s victory, and that appeal was heard at the BC Court of Appeal.
In response to the growing number of evictions and the effects on communities, several Vancouver residents along with the West End Residents Association (WERA) have started the “Renters at Risk” Campaign to engage in public education and lobby the provincial government to make three specific changes to the Residential Tenancy Act.
• Remove the ability for landlords to ask for voluntary rent increases.
• Remove the ability for landlords to increase rent to geographic market rates.
• Remove the ability for landlords to evict tenants to evade legistlated rent increases.
